  • Abstract
    Coherent deep-UV radiation is produced by Yb-fiber-laser based cavity-enhanced high-harmonic generation at 80-MHz repetition rate. The intracavity-power exceeds 3kW and up to 17th harmonics are outcoupled by thin Brewster´s plate made by MgO crystal.
